Money Management for Beginners

Embarking on your money management quest can feel overwhelming, but mastering the fundamentals of budgeting is easier than you think! Start by monitoring your income and expenses. A simple spreadsheet can work wonders. Categorize your expenses to get a clear picture of where your money is going. This understanding will empower you to recognize areas where you can save and allocate your funds more efficiently. Remember, budgeting isn't about restriction, but about making conscious choices.

  • Set realistic goals
  • Create a monthly budget
  • Review and adjust regularly

Work-From-Home Wins: Productivity Hacks That Actually Work

Working from home can be a blessing, but staying focused and productive sometimes feels like an uphill battle. Distractions are lurking around every corner, from the laundry pile to that enticing Netflix queue. But don't stress! With a few savvy productivity hacks up your sleeve, you can reclaim your workday and accomplish your goals. Here are some tried-and-true tips to boost your work-from-home output:

  • Create a dedicated workspace: It doesn't have to be a fancy office, but having a designated area for work helps signal your brain that it's time to focus.
  • Schedule your day: Just like you would in an office, set clear goals for each day and stick to a framework. This helps create structure and minimize deferring.
  • Utilize regular breaks: Stepping away from your desk can actually enhance your productivity. Get up, stretch, go for a walk, or do something else that helps you recharge.
  • Collaborate: Staying in touch with colleagues and managers is important for teamwork and motivation. Utilize regular check-ins and meetings to stay on the same page.

Remember, finding the right work-from-home balance takes time and experimentation. Don't be afraid to try different things until you discover what works best for you. With a little effort, you can turn your home office into a haven of productivity and success!

Thrive in Your 30s: Healthy Habits for Long-Term Wellness

Your twenties and thirties is a time of incredible transformation and growth. To maximize this stage, it's essential to cultivate healthy habits that support your physical, mental, and emotional well-being. By adopting these practices, you can set the stage for a lifetime of well-being.

First and foremost, nourish your body with a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ein. Regular exercise is also crucial for enhancing your energy levels, mood, and overall health.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ity activity most days of the week.

Schedule in restful sleep each night to allow your body to regenerate. Stress management techniques like yoga, meditation, or spending time in nature can help reduce stress and promote mental clarity.

Finally, cultivate strong social connections and relationships that provide support and motivation. Surrounding yourself with positive people who share your values can make a significant difference in your overall well-being.
